Russ Nichols — Moderator

Senior Fellow, Center for Digital Government

Russ Nichols’ public service spanned over 32 years and included management and executive positions with the California Department of Forestry and Fire Protection, the California State Controller’s Office, and the Employment Development Department. In 2015, Nichols was appointed by Governor Jerry Brown as the California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ation Chief Information Officer and Director of Enterprise Information Services. While serving at the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ation, Nichols also served as a board member for the Corrections Technology Association and served as CTA President from 2019 to 2021. In February 2021, Governor Gavin Newsom appointed Nichols Deputy State CIO and Chief Deputy Director at California Department of Technology. Prior to retirement, Nichols also served as Acting State CIO and CDT Director for several months.
